1. Data Consolidation and Integration
- Aggregate Data Sources: Pull together internal data (sales, operations, finance, HR) and external data (market trends, competitor analysis, customer sentiment).
- Use AI-powered ETL Tools: Automate data cleaning, normalization, and integration to create a unified data lake for better insights.
2. Predictive Analytics for Market Trends
- Forecast Demand and Sales: Use machine learning models to predict future customer demand, seasonal trends, and product performance.
- Identify Emerging Opportunities: Analyze external market data to spot new industry trends or potential disruptions early.
3. Scenario Planning and Simulation
- AI-driven Scenario Modeling: Use AI to simulate different strategic scenarios (e.g., market entry, pricing changes, supply chain disruptions).
- Risk Assessment: Quantify risks and potential impacts for each scenario to support more informed decisions.
4. Enhanced Competitive Analysis
- Natural Language Processing (NLP): Analyze competitor news, financial reports, and social media to gauge competitor strategy and sentiment.
- Benchmarking: Use AI to benchmark company performance against industry standards and competitors dynamically.
5. Customer Insights and Personalization
- Segmentation: Apply clustering algorithms to segment customers more precisely based on behavior and preferences.
- Feedback Analysis: Use sentiment analysis on customer feedback to inform product development and service improvements.
6. Resource Allocation Optimization
- AI-based Resource Planning: Optimize allocation of budget, personnel, and capital by predicting ROI of different strategic initiatives.
- Dynamic Adjustments: Continuously monitor execution and adjust plans based on real-time performance data.
7. Decision Support Systems
- AI Assistants: Integrate AI-driven dashboards and virtual assistants that provide actionable insights and answer strategic queries.
- Automated Reporting: Generate insightful reports highlighting key strategic metrics, anomalies, and opportunities.
8. Continuous Learning and Improvement
- Feedback Loops: Implement AI systems that learn from past decisions and outcomes to improve future planning accuracy.
- Knowledge Management: Use AI to capture organizational knowledge and best practices for strategic planning.
Implementation Tips
- Start Small: Pilot AI tools in a specific department before scaling.
- Cross-functional Teams: Involve data scientists, strategists, and domain experts to ensure AI insights are relevant.
- Ethical and Transparent AI: Maintain transparency in AI decision-making to build trust and comply with regulations.
